High Death Roll In Earthquakes

NEW DELHI, June 20

(A.A.P.-Reuter). — More than 20,000 people are thought to have died in earthquakes which rocked Afghanistan last week, according to Kabul

radio.

The broadcast said casualty reports were still incomplete because of dislocated communi- cations.

Several villages in the Kun- har River Valley were wiped out by thousands of tons of debris. Tremors cascaded rocks and debris on to hamlets from mountain slopes.

More than 140 people were killed and about 900 injured when the Kunhar River burst its banks, flooding a large area of the country.
